March 11, 2022
The 14th Annual Patricia & Douglas Perry Honors College Undergraduate Research Symposium is scheduled for 9 a.m. to 5 p.m. on March 19.
The symposium, which offers undergraduate students the opportunity to showcase the results of their research, creativity, and scholarship in a public forum, is designed as a hybrid event. Last year it was all virtual.
The poster session and art exhibit will be held in person from 9 a.m. to 11 a.m. at the Learning Commons at Perry Library, with oral presentations scheduled from 1 p.m. to 5 p.m. via Zoom.
There are 80 art, oral and poster presentations scheduled. About 150 students and their mentor teachers are expected to attend.
